medusoid

adjective

Of, relating to, or resembling a medusa or a jellyfish.

adjective

Designating or relating to the medusa stage in the life cycle of a cnidarian.

noun

A medusalike bud developed from a hydrozoan polyp, a medusa, or a jellyfish.

Like a medusa; resembling a medusa in form or function; medusiform: as, a medusoid bud; the medusoid organization. Sometimes acalephoid.

noun

The medusiform generative bud or receptacle of the reproductive elements of a hydrozoan, whether it becomes detached or not.

noun

Loosely, any medusa, medusidan, or medusoid organism.

adjective

Like a medusa; having the fundamental structure of a medusa, but without a locomotive disk; — said of the sessile gonophores of hydroids.
